Perfect Spicy Shrimp Scampi Recipe Ingredients

  1. You need 1 lb of large devained & cleaned shrimp.
  2. You need 1/3 cup of butter.
  3. Prepare 1 tbsp of minced garlic.
  4. You need 1 tbsp of parsley.
  5. You need 1/4 cup of dry white wine.
  6. It's 1 tsp of salt.
  7. It's 1 tsp of pepper.
  8. It's 1 tsp of red jalapeno in jar.
  9. It's 1 tsp of dried onion flakes.
  10. It's 1/2 tsp of italian seasoning.
  11. You need 1 of lemons for side.
  12. You need 2 tbsp of olive oil.
  13. It's 1 pinch of red pepper flaked.

How to make Spicy Shrimp Scampi from scracth

  1. add butter, garlic & olive oil to pan cook about 3-4 minutes on med heat. Add in wine, and jalapeno paste cook another 3 minutes let wine cook out. Add in shrimp and all seasonings cook till shrimp turn pink about 4-5 minutes..
  2. serve with whatever sides and lemons..
